Al Sharpton and Carol Moseley Braun at Front of Web Pack in performance so far....

Keynote will be reporting on the "response time" and "success rate" of the leading presidential candidate's Web sites, including George Bush's site and the official sites of the Democrats and Republicans, now till the election in November 2004.

We are measuring the sites' performance with Keynote's market-leading infrastructure of real-time measurement computers located around the United States.
